Advancing Tibet’s Constitution

Tibetan Publius is a civic, legal, and intellectual platform dedicated to advancing the constitutional foundation of a future free and independent Tibet through legal scholarship, informed public discourse, and policy engagement. Grounded in the principles of rule of law, democratic governance, and Tibetan national consciousness, Tibetan Publius seeks to shape a durable constitutional framework that promotes unity, stability, and effective self-governance for Tibet’s future sovereignty.

Our Core Focus:

  • Advancing constitutional development for a future free and independent Tibet

  • Researching Tibet’s legal history and governance systems

  • Examining Tibetan legal structures and democratic institutions in exile

  • Addressing legal and policy issues affecting the Tibetan diaspora

  • Strengthening national unity and constitutional order to help safeguard a future independent Tibet from internal division, civil conflict, or partition

  • Serving as an interactive forum for informed discussion and debate on the future constitution of a free Tibet

Tibetan Publius is committed to bridging Tibet’s legal past with its constitutional future by advancing rigorous scholarship, institutional development, and responsible leadership in service of a strong, unified, and sovereign Tibet.
